public static class Sip.Builder extends TwiML.Builder<Sip.Builder>
<Sip>
elementConstructor and Description |
---|
Builder(String sipUrl)
Create a
<Sip> with sipUrl |
Builder(URI sipUrl)
Create a
<Sip> with sipUrl |
Modifier and Type | Method and Description |
---|---|
Sip |
build()
Create and return resulting
<Sip> element |
Sip.Builder |
method(HttpMethod method)
Action URL method
|
Sip.Builder |
password(String password)
SIP Password
|
Sip.Builder |
statusCallback(String statusCallback)
Status callback URL
|
Sip.Builder |
statusCallback(URI statusCallback)
Status callback URL
|
Sip.Builder |
statusCallbackEvents(List<Sip.Event> statusCallbackEvent)
Status callback events
|
Sip.Builder |
statusCallbackEvents(Sip.Event statusCallbackEvent)
Status callback events
|
Sip.Builder |
statusCallbackMethod(HttpMethod statusCallbackMethod)
Status callback URL method
|
Sip.Builder |
url(String url)
Action URL
|
Sip.Builder |
url(URI url)
Action URL
|
Sip.Builder |
username(String username)
SIP Username
|
addChild, addText, option
public Builder(URI sipUrl)
<Sip>
with sipUrlpublic Builder(String sipUrl)
<Sip>
with sipUrlpublic Sip.Builder username(String username)
public Sip.Builder password(String password)
public Sip.Builder url(URI url)
public Sip.Builder url(String url)
public Sip.Builder method(HttpMethod method)
public Sip.Builder statusCallbackEvents(List<Sip.Event> statusCallbackEvent)
public Sip.Builder statusCallbackEvents(Sip.Event statusCallbackEvent)
public Sip.Builder statusCallback(URI statusCallback)
public Sip.Builder statusCallback(String statusCallback)
public Sip.Builder statusCallbackMethod(HttpMethod statusCallbackMethod)
public Sip build()
<Sip>
elementCopyright © 2019 Twilio, Inc. All Rights Reserved.